Great selection of foodstuffs and some cookery tools. Super friendly staff. Love their queso fresco for arepas and gorditas. I have not found this number of Latin American & Spanish groceries anywhere else in Melbourne.
If you are looking for Spanish, Portuguese or South American food this is the place to go. Great range, worth the look
